HC Deb 27 June 1949 vol 466 cc49-50W
75. Mr. Jeger

asked the Minister of Food whether he has considered the advertisement, of which a copy has been sent to him, of a Yorkshire firm appearing in a Hampshire paper offering chocolates at 11s. for 2 lbs.; and whether he will now restore rationing of sweets to ensure that all who cannot afford to buy large quantities at high prices get fair shares.

Dr. Summerskill

We have made inquiries and the prices advertised are those authorised by my Department. As regards the reimposition of rationing, I can add nothing at present to the reply given by my right hon. Friend on 22nd June to my hon. Friend the Member for Kings Norton (Mr. Blackburn).

85. Dr. Broughton

asked the Minister of Food whether he will now take steps to ensure that a supply of sweets is available for every child.

Dr. Summerskill

So long as demand is in excess of supply I do not think we can do what my hon. Friend proposes except by the resumption of rationing.
